Dynamic DNS Tab
Dynamic Domain Name Service (DDNS) allows a user with a non-static IP address to keep their
domain name associated with an ever changing IP address. As an example, DDNS is used when you
are hosting your own website.
Table 3-7 Dynamic DNS Tab
Field or Button Description
Enable DDNS Check this box to Enable DDNS (default is unchecked).
DDNS Service Provider Select DDNS Service Provider that you belong to from
the drop-down box.
DDNS User Name Only valid if Enable DDNS is checked. Enter your DDNS
account user name.
DDNS Password Only valid if Enable DDNS is checked. Enter your DDNS
account password.
DDNS Host Name Only valid if Enable DDNS is checked. Enter the DDNS
Host Name. This is assigned by the DDNS service.
Click Apply when you
are finished.
